Catriona MacColl (born 3 October 1954) is an English actress and former ballerina. She was initially a ballerina who trained at a top ballet school in England before suffering an injury that abruptly curtailed her burgeoning career as a dancer. In the wake of said injury Catriona joined a repertory company which eventually led to her moving to Paris, France where she acted in French television shows and played her first lead role as the titular character in Lady Oscar (1979). She gained cinema popularity by playing the female leads in three gruesome and atmospheric Italian horror films directed by Lucio Fulci: City of the Living Dead (1980), The Beyond (1981), and The House by the Cemetery (1981).
